Transaction ec4c40be346a4443faef2482154d6c2efcbe80e53b9efb62b5da0ff521c7a72e
2 Input
2 Outputs
- ec4c40be346a4443faef2482154d6c2efcbe80e53b9efb62b5da0ff521c7a72e:0
- ec4c40be346a4443faef2482154d6c2efcbe80e53b9efb62b5da0ff521c7a72e:1
value 81162
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 54650000
address 1GduXhZrxXoWhUPaSVhimCb1SD9P4PTcbQ